>>> > With or without certifications, hiring managers are struggling to
>>> find
>>> > Linux professionals. 88 percent report that it's "very difficult" or
>>> > "somewhat difficult" to find qualified candidates. Fortunately for
>>> those
>>> > with Linux skills, 70 percent of hiring managers say "their companies
>>> have
>>> > increased incentives to retain Linux talent, with 37 percent offering
>>> more
>>> > flexible work hours and telecommuting, and 36 percent increasing
>>> salaries
>>> > for Linux pros more than in other parts of the company."
